Most 'fresh imports' are ****e from docks auctions and they will certainly have had their original (Japanese auction) appraisal sheet destroyed. An 'auction sheet' from a docks auction but would good only for wiping your **** on. A high-grade car from a decent importer will be sold with the auction sheet as this established the vehicles grade at auction and its part of the cars's provenance.

as simon says! pardon the pun! no auction report defo not to be purchased, doesnt look to bad an example , but it looks like its seen quite a bit of paint work, the side skirt rubber seals have been colour coded due to yhe lack of masking tape and the back passenger side quarter / wheel arch has seen some repair work too, thats just from looking at the pics in the advert, from my own experience i have seen a lot of jdm imprezas that have had repaire work on the passenger quarter wheel arch area, must be due to parking in japan etc, i would be very carefull when looking at this car , also look at the inside of the doors to see if the skins have been replaced etc etc the check list is really to indepth to go into , an auction report is really essential and a service history is a bonus too, the auction report also confirms if there was a service history when the car was appraised in japan, cos the service historys dont always get here, i have mine sent by air mail with all of the other docs.
